1. The Paradigm Shift: Eliminating Rotor Losses without Rare-Earth Magnets

In standard induction motors (IE2, IE3), rotor magnetizing currents generate significant electrical resistance losses ($I^2R$), accounting for up to 20% to 25% of total motor energy dissipation. Conventional high-efficiency alternatives, such as Permanent Magnet Synchronous Motors (PMSM), eliminate these rotor copper losses but introduce critical vulnerabilities: reliance on volatile rare-earth element supply chains (Neodymium, Dysprosium), risk of irreversible magnetic demagnetization under high ambient temperatures, and complex recycling requirements.

The IE5 Synchronous Reluctance Motor (SynRM) bypasses both constraints through pure magnetic reluctance torque principles. The rotor is manufactured using precision-cut electrical steel laminations structured with multi-layered flux barriers. When energized by a Variable Frequency Drive (VFD) via field-oriented vector control, the magnetic field aligns along the axis of minimum reluctance ($d$-axis). Because zero electrical current flows through the SynRM rotor, rotor copper losses are completely eliminated.

2. Thermal Dynamics & Extended Insulation Longevity

Because heat generation in a SynRM rotor is virtually non-existent, thermal energy is concentrated almost entirely within the stator windings, where it can be efficiently dissipated through external cast-iron frame fins and low-power cooling fans. This cool-running rotor architecture yields profound mechanical and electrical advantages:

  • Lower Bearing Temperatures: Bearing operating temperatures are reduced by 15°C to 25°C compared to equivalent-frame induction motors, effectively doubling grease relubrication intervals and bearing service life.
  • Thermal Class Margin: Built with Class H insulation systems but rated strictly for Class B temperature rises, our IE5 SynRM units maintain an immense safety reserve against voltage spikes, harmonic distortions, and high ambient operating environments common in heavy manufacturing hubs like Sesto San Giovanni and Rho.
  • Consistent Partial-Load Efficiency: Unlike standard induction motors whose efficiency curves collapse sharply when loaded below 60%, SynRM technology retains near-peak IE5 ultra-premium efficiency down to 25% rated load.

EU Ecodesign Regulation (EU 2019/1781) & Beyond

Since July 2023, European law mandates a minimum of IE4 efficiency for 3-phase electric motors between 75kW and 200kW. Can an IE5 Synchronous Reluctance Motor run directly across-the-line (DOL)?

No. SynRM motors require a Variable Frequency Drive (VFD) equipped with specialized vector control or Maximum Torque Per Ampere (MTPA) algorithms to initiate rotation and maintain synchronous rotor alignment. Is an IE5 SynRM mechanically interchangeable with existing standard IEC frame motors?

Yes. Our IE5 SynRM motor range adheres strictly to IEC standard shaft heights, mounting dimensions (B3 foot, B5 flange, B35 combination), and CENELEC frame specifications (IEC 80 to 355). You can drop an IE5 SynRM into the exact physical footprint of an older IE2 or IE3 induction motor without modifying baseplates or couplings.

How does SynRM technology perform in high ambient temperature environments?

Because zero current passes through the rotor, rotor operating heat is practically eliminated. Bearings run significantly cooler, grease degradation is dramatically slowed, and thermal stress on motor insulation is minimized, making SynRM exceptionally suited for hot industrial processes, unconditioned plant rooms, and summertime peak temperatures across Southern Europe.
